Larry Nassar
Larry Nassar is a former USA Gymnastics doctor who was convicted of sexually abusing young female athletes, including members of the U.S. women's gymnastics team. His actions led to a nationwide scandal that exposed systemic failures in protecting athletes from abuse and prompted widespread reforms within sports organizations.
